Type
ORACLE
Validation date
2023-09-19 01: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0283,
    "usd": 0.03024
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C4B4DF73DFF023CB2A8A2F76AF38E0DB35AEC705B218FBAF91F1D4FFC2529364

Previous signature

5E69E1C477CE418EEFC505F2C89692552F605569704A57A377EDDD1DFE06AB396C85483509217BE88BB19E9959D82355C1E485F65B96F2D5ACAC249C38AC3003

Origin signature

3046022100C509E9CC1E8DC583D1651EB29A53CF504E70A8412CDCA30B0FF0A6006645DD0A0221008DBE65527680DC31879FDD8574A8B117AF42D159B0692C25BF4C378CF6E59E9F

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

008D6FDEB5DAB1786B02A583A884E57DAB471F09CAA571840A37F5EB20A2B5B2C1

Coordinator signature

634A4B951274480AE5680E39203B79A5F01C0DF168488B165B99B8F4F3E161925B33F40499674D019198825224AA7D209D6830A64B659DF52CA4F527E23C7F0A

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

0CAE5B21C1B5BD1D11114B5AE997A569EC7AD5A740E1840F693FB4DA0DF6062F2045B7CC085A797BEA0CFCB02AD88E38A9B3DD063E4D7F3764FA4BE861C1CB03

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

B68236DCCDB73FB156A889B73A0C39B589C88226C53670EDE386C9A6BFF447C7264FC0F3B0838FAA71EC9C08318572A33CBD540D8DE7E9DAF5B700F8D083E20B